kami 11831c6ace Gate recall on the margin over the runner-up, not just the score
The e5 embedder puts every cosine in one narrow band (0.79-0.89), so the
absolute query_min_score gate cannot tell a real hit from a made-up
question: any value under the band answers everything, any value above it
answers nothing. False recall was 5/5.

New gate asks whether one note is clearly the best instead: top1 - top2 >
delta. New query_min_margin config knob, default 0.008, read off the sweep
in the recall harness. The absolute floor stays as a second check.

On the recall fixture with e5: answered 72% -> 68%, false recall 5/5 -> 1/5.

kami 20184874b2 Add the morning routine engine — a daily checklist, not four timers
Backlog item #3 (20-07-2026-BACKLOG.md). A morning routine is a checklist for
a daily window: several items, each evidenced by a fact key, completed in any
order, checked once near the end of the window. Modelling it as four
independent reminder timers would stack into exactly the kind of noise Maven is
supposed not to produce, so the engine nags at most once per day per routine
and only for what is actually still missing.

internal/morning follows the established pure-engine pattern (loop, routine,
pattern): no store, no clock of its own. Evaluate answers "what's still
missing" at any point; Due decides whether to nag. The impurity — reading
facts under the store lock, holding the last-nudge map across ticks — stays in
the tick driver, which calls Due each tick exactly as it does for loop.Rule
and routine.Routine.

Completion evidence is a fact key's latest non-voided value timestamped inside
today's window, so manual ("выпил воды", voice-tapped) and inferred (another
daemon writing the same key) are indistinguishable and both count. Weekdays
scopes which days a routine applies to, so weekday/weekend variants are two
routine rows rather than a special case in the engine.

Exposed read-only: a MorningStatus RPC over ipc, and a /morning page in mavweb
built on the same server-rendered shape as /trace — no live-update loop, since
checklist state moves on the scale of minutes.

kami 76a6a007ef Pin the resident model to Qwen3.5-0.8B and name Qwen3-1.7B as the target
The most load-bearing decision in the project was stated four incompatible
ways: the docs said Qwen3-1.7B, deploy/mavend.json said Qwen3.5-2B, the repo's
models/llm/ held an LFM2.5-1.2B gguf, and five code comments still said LFM.
Answering "which model is deployed" meant re-deriving it from scratch every
time.

Two facts the review missed, found while resolving it:

- /mnt/hdd1/llms is bind-mounted over /opt/maven/models/llm, which shadows the
  repo's models/llm/. The LFM2.5 gguf sitting there was never loaded by
  anything, so it was not evidence of the deployed model at all.
- That library holds Qwen3.5-0.8B, -2B and -4B, and no Qwen3-1.7B. The config
  pointed at a file that does exist; the docs' Qwen3-1.7B was the stale claim,
  the reverse of the assumed direction. Qwen3-1.7B is the CPT target, and that
  training is still in flight (Vikunja #122), so no such gguf exists yet.

phraser.model_path moves to Qwen3.5-0.8B (Q4_K_M) — the smallest checkpoint on
disk, chosen for latency, and relevant to whether the LLM router is affordable
on this box. Docs and comments now say the same thing in one voice: 0.8B
resident now, CPT'd Qwen3-1.7B as the target, and the bind-mount shadowing
written down so the next reader does not mistake models/llm/ for ground truth.
Comments name the model, never a filename, so a swap stays a one-line config
change.

n_gpu_layers: 99 is correct and stays — compose passes /dev/dri and the render
gid for Vulkan offload to the Vega iGPU. CLAUDE.md's "CPU-only" was the stale
half of that contradiction and is corrected.

phraser.go also dropped a wrong "sub-1b, prompted not trained" size claim: the
target is trained end-to-end (RU CPT + joint persona/router SFT).

kami ce3d8e65f2 voice/routing: fix time-query misroute (seed collision, threshold, stage-0 grammars)
three bugs causing time queries to land on reminder or fact intent:

- seed collision: query.txt and system.txt shared identical time/date
  seeds (который час, сколько времени), making system intent
  indistinguishable from query intent in centroid space
- threshold (0.35) too low for ONNX embedder — cosine similarities
  cluster 0.5-0.7 for related intents, so Clarify never fired
- reminder centroid contaminated by time-lexicon (every seed has a time
  expression), pulling any time-word utterance toward reminder intent

fixes:
- remove 3 duplicate time/date seeds from query.txt (keep in system.txt)
- DefaultRouterThreshold 0.35 -> 0.55
- stage-0 grammar for напомни/remind me -> IntentReminder, bypasses
  classifier (fixes 'напомни через час' being misrouted to fact)
- stage-0 grammars for time/date system queries (сколько времени,
  который час, какой сегодня день) -> IntentSystem, with Build filter
  to exclude elapsed/duration queries (сколько времени прошло)
- time parser fallback in applyAction for stage-0 reminder matches
  (extractor doesn't run on stage-0 decisions)

kami 59a4e06615 maven: scheduled routines + persistent long-term memory
Two additive proactive/recall features.

Routines (internal/routine): a third proactive class beside reminders
(user-stated) and care rules (world-state) — operator-declared clockwork.
config.routines[] (cron + literal RU body + severity) fire through the
normal dispatcher on schedule. Bodies are literal, not LLM-phrased (can't
hallucinate); rule name routine:<name> keeps them out of the care
autotuner; a cold-start guard seeds on first sight so a restart never
replays a missed schedule. Pure routine.Due + config validation, unit-
tested; the tick driver holds the last-fired map and calls fireRoutines.

Persistent memory (internal/store/memory.go): store.MemoryStore backs the
memory.Store interface with the SAME encrypted sqlite db — survives
restarts and recall text inherits at-rest encryption (no plaintext
sidecar). float32-blob vectors, brute-force cosine (ANN is a later swap
behind the interface), upsert-by-id. The daemon wires st.VectorMemory()
into wireVoice; the in-memory impl stays the test/no-store floor. Closes
the "in-memory only, lost on restart" gap (PROGRESS #8).

Gate green: gofmt/vet clean, -race across routine/config/store/mavend.
